Summary of the contracting process

The Legal, Democratic and Business Intelligence department of Swansea Council has issued a tender titled "Contract for Renewal Of Windows And Doors at 34 Properties at Woodside Crescent, Brynteg and Players" in the works category. The purpose of this procurement is to upgrade the thermal value of 34 properties through window and door replacements. The tender period ends on August 17, 2023, and the award period ends on August 29, 2023.

This tender presents an opportunity for businesses involved in building construction, joinery, and carpentry installation works. Companies registered with FENSA and specialising in window and door installations would be well-suited to compete. The procurement process is currently in the open stage, allowing interested suppliers to participate by submitting their bids before the specified deadline.

Notice Description

The purpose of the regeneration is to carry out works to upgrade Thermal Value of the existing 34nr Properties. Properties within regeneration scheme are tenanted 2/3 Bed semi-detached properties and 2 storey flats. External wall fabric is traditional cavity wall construction made up of an internal blockwork skin, 50mm cavity and a pebble dashed blockwork / brickwork external facade. Window specification is taken from Rehau Windows. We will accept any other system/manufacturer that is equal in specification, as checked by the PM, should the tendering contractor wish to put forward in their tender submission. The Contractor shall not use any materials on site unless it is specified in their schedule, without the prior approval in writing by the Project Manager. Remove existing windows and replace with new double glazed white PVCu windows. See window sections for details.Bidders must be must be FENSA registered.Works as detailed in this specification.NOTE: The authority is using eTenderwales to carry out this procurement process.
